Transaction f4f7924650ba01e25b824f52a3e58a7d9fb0b255d1ea982750e965e96978eb13
1 Input
1 Output
-
f4f7924650ba01e25b824f52a3e58a7d9fb0b255d1ea982750e965e96978eb13:0
- value
- 70805937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61a051618f2c2566525fb74e64828a2ff41aec55 OP_EQUAL
- address
- 3AbDXEXAjYzDZenqKFg8t6DicWqcsznhKq